## Broker Upgrade: Limits and Quotas

Before promoting the Cinderhook broker from 4.x to 5.x, the release manager must confirm that all tenant quotas survive the migration; the new version enforces partition caps strictly rather than advisorily, so any tenant currently over-quota will be throttled immediately after cutover. Verify each value against the constants listed below.

constants for yajof-hadup:
RATE_LIMITS = {
    "druael": 2,
    "ralael": 10,
}

## Formula sandbox tuning

User-supplied formulas in Gridmoor execute inside a restricted interpreter with hard ceilings on time, memory, and call depth. Reviewers should confirm any change to these ceilings is justified in the PR description, since raising them widens the abuse surface. Defaults were chosen from production traces. The current limits are as follows.

limits module of tafog-fawip:
WEIGHTS = {
    "julix": 57,
    "lamys": 992,
    "kasvan": 209,
    "quenok": 750,
    "alddor": 259,
    "oliath": 1009,
    "wenix": 815,
}

Ticket: Invoice PDFs rendered by Perlstone's billing service clip the line-item table when a customer has more than 40 entries. Pagination logic in the renderer assumes a fixed row height, but discounted rows wrap to two lines. Affects roughly 2% of monthly invoices. Workaround: regenerate with the legacy template. On-call should confirm the fix lands in the next hotfix. Failing render trace follows.

pipeline stamp: htk9_ce63042d9